Pressure Cooker Instructions: Once you have the ingredients in the pressure cooker, and the beef submerged in water, place on the lid and ensure the value is sealed. Cook on high pressure for 90 minutes and natural release for 15 minutes, before manually releasing any remaining pressure. Carefully remove the corned beef and place it on a chopping board. Cover loosely with foil and let it rest for 15 minutes before slicing against the grain.
